r <br /> <br />Climate in the area is semi-arid, with approximately 15 inches of precipitation annually. Forty- <br />four (44) percent of the total annual precipitation comes in the form of rainfall during the <br />months of May, July and August, and sixty-seven (67) percent occurs between May and <br />October. Wind speeds average slightly over 8 miles per hour on an annual basis and are out of <br />the southwest one third of the time. <br />Description of the Operation and Reclamation Plans <br />Only surface mining will be conducted at the Lorencito Canyon mine. The total anticipated <br />affected and disturbed area is approximately I S l7 acres. Map 2.05.3-1 of the permit <br />application depicts the mine plan and the life-of--mine plan. <br />Disturbance at the site will begin with haul road construction up to the Jeff Canyon surface <br />mine, modifying and upgrading the existing road, as necessary. Sediment ponds will be <br />constructed in side drainage valleys as necessary. A coal loadout area of about 5 acres will be <br />developed along the Purgatoire River valley adjacent to the Trinidad rail line. Only surface <br />mining in the Jeff Canyon area will occur during the frst three years, with contour mining <br />beginning in year 4 in lower Lorencito Canyon. Surface mining operations in the Jeff Canyon <br />area will be conducted using mountaintop removal techniques. <br />Surface mining will commence at the eastern side of the ridge between Jeff Canyon and the <br />Purgatoire River. Mining will progress to the west, with development of a highwall and fill <br />construction in the small side drainages. Overburden material will be moved using a <br />combination of dozers, trucks and loaders, and cast blasting. Sediment control structures will <br />be constructed in advance of the disturbance in each watershed. Overburden material will be <br />regraded to approximate the original contour prior to re-application of subsoil and/or topsoil <br />material. <br />Surface mine facilities will be portable and moved as the mine progresses. Coal will be shuttled <br />by rail from the rail loadout at the mouth of Lorencito Canyon to the New Elk mine site (permit <br />no. C-81-012) located approximately 8 miles to the west. Coal mill then be washed (if <br />necessary) in the prep plant and/or loaded onto unit trains for transportation to market. Refuse <br />will be disposed of in the existing refuse disposal area (RDA) at the New Elk site. <br />The applicant estimates 1.6 million cubic yards of topsoil and subsoil will be removed. Some <br />of this topsoil will be stockpiled for re-application. However, much of the topsoil material will <br />belive-handled on the surface mine area, when possible. Topsoil will be re-applied to a depth <br />of .9 feet at the surface mine, l .6 feet along reclaimed roadways, 2.5 feet at the loadout, and .9 <br />feet at the pond locations. <br />The revegetation plan has three main objectives. The first is to assist in controlling excessive <br />erosion and sedimentation. Secondly, the objective is to establish a vegetative cover that is <br />ecologically comparative to the native, pre-mine community. A final objective is to restore <br />wildlife, grazing, watershed, and aesthetic values to meet the post-mining land use. <br />
